What is RFID?
RFID uses radio waves to automatically identify and track tags attached to objects. The tags contain electronically stored information that can be read from up to several meters away.
What is NFC?
NFC is a short-range wireless technology that enables communication between devices when they're touched or brought within a few centimeters. It's the technology behind contactless payments and smartphone tags.

Tag or Chip
An RFID tag or NFC chip is embedded in a card, phone, key fob, or device.
Reader Detects
A reader emits radio waves that power and communicate with the tag or chip.
Action Triggered
The reader processes the data and triggers an action: open door, verify identity, process payment, etc.
